The Importance of Iodine in Our Diet

Iodine plays a vital role in our health, primarily influencing thyroid function. This trace element is essential for producing thyroid hormones, which regulate metabolism, growth, and development. A deficiency can lead to various health issues, including goiter, hypothyroidism, and developmental problems in children. Interestingly, iodine isn’t produced by the body; it must be obtained through diet or supplements. Foods rich in iodine include seafood, dairy products, grains, and certain fruits and vegetables. Symptoms of Iodine Deficiency

Recognizing the symptoms of iodine deficiency can be tricky since they often overlap with other health issues. Common signs include fatigue, weight gain or loss, hair loss, dry skin, and difficulty concentrating. In severe cases, individuals may develop goiter—a noticeable swelling of the thyroid gland located at the base of the neck. This condition occurs as the body tries to compensate for low hormone production due to insufficient iodine intake.

Pregnant women are particularly vulnerable to iodine deficiency since their bodies require more of this nutrient to support fetal development. Insufficient iodine during pregnancy can lead to intellectual disabilities and developmental delays in children. Methods of Testing Iodine Levels

There are several methods available for testing iodine levels in the body. Each method has its advantages and disadvantages depending on accessibility and accuracy requirements. Here’s a quick overview:

1. Urinary Iodine Concentration: This is the most common method used worldwide because it reflects recent dietary intake of iodine. A sample of urine is collected and analyzed for its iodine content.

2. Blood Tests: Blood tests measure thyroglobulin or thyroid hormone levels as indirect indicators of iodine status.

3. Iodine Patch Test: This home-based method involves applying a tincture of iodine on the skin and monitoring how quickly it’s absorbed over 24 hours.

4. Saliva Testing: Though less common than urinary tests, saliva testing can also be used to gauge iodine levels.

Each method has its own set of pros and cons; however, urinary concentration tends to be the gold standard due to its ease of use and direct correlation with dietary intake.

The Role of Diet in Maintaining Iodine Levels

Diet plays an indispensable role in maintaining adequate iodine levels in the body. Incorporating foods rich in this essential nutrient can make a significant difference in preventing deficiencies. Seaweed is one of the richest sources of natural iodine; just one serving can provide several times the daily recommended intake! Other excellent sources include fish (like cod), dairy products (yogurt and milk), eggs, grains (especially those grown near coastal areas), and iodized salt—an easy way to ensure adequate intake without much effort.

It’s important not only to consume these foods but also to understand how cooking methods affect their nutritional value—boiling vegetables may leach out some nutrients including iodine! Overall balance is key; focusing solely on one food group could lead to other deficiencies or imbalances over time.

For those following restrictive diets such as veganism or vegetarianism—where seafood might be limited—considering fortified foods or supplements becomes crucial if dietary sources fall short over time.

Iodine Supplements: When Are They Necessary?

In certain situations, supplements may be necessary if dietary sources are insufficient or if specific life stages demand higher amounts—like pregnancy or lactation when requirements increase significantly! However, self-prescribing supplements without proper testing isn’t advisable; excessive amounts can lead to toxicity or worsen existing thyroid conditions.

Consulting with healthcare professionals before starting any supplementation regimen ensures that individuals receive personalized recommendations based on their unique needs rather than generic guidelines that may not apply universally!

Food Source Iodine Content (mcg per serving)
Seaweed (Nori) 16-2000 mcg
Cod Fish 99 mcg
Dairy Milk (1 cup) 56 mcg
Iodized Salt (1 tsp) 400 mcg
Eggs (1 large) 24 mcg
